Wholly Committed
God has a great and wonderful plan that will be accomplished. God works through His faithful children to fulfill His divine purposes. God wants to work through each one of us. However, we choose whether we will be a part of God’s eternal design or whether He will work through someone else. Where do we start?
We must be consumed with God’s will with a Holy Zeal. Some Christians loose their motivation, enthusiasm and fire shortly after their initial commitment. Zeal must be renewed every day through the power of the Holy Spirit. Paul told the Roman church, “Never be lacking in zeal, but keep your spiritual fervor, serving the Lord.” (Romans 12:11)
We must be committed to God’s Word with a Holy Hunger. When your soul is starving for God, you will do anything to be filled with His Word. Jesus said, “Blessed are those who hunger and thirst for righteousness, for they will be filled.” (Matthew 5:6) We must not only have an open Bible but an open mind to understand and an open heart to accept God’s will. “Like newborn babies, crave pure spiritual milk, so that by it you may grow up in your salvation, now that you have tasted that the Lord is good.” (1 Peter 2:2-3)
We must be dedicated to prayer with a Holy Passion. Prayer releases the almighty power of God to work in our lives. Without it we are empty, weak, ignorant and vulnerable. Prayer opens our lives for God to work. Paul didn’t dare live, act, speak or move without prayer. He told the church, “Pray continually.” (1 Thessalonians 5:17)
We must love the Lord God with a Holy Heart. When several things are competing for our heart the outcome is dangerous. Both the Old Law and the New Covenant are summed up in “love the Lord with all of your heart.” (Deuteronomy 6:5; Matthew 22:37) That doesn’t leave room in our heart for worldly, sinful or even selfish and personal interests.
God will do wonderful things today. He will demonstrate His power. He will reveal His plan. Decide that you will open your mind, heart, soul, will to be an active part in God’s supreme work!
